Industry: Northbeam operates in the technology industry, specifically focusing on marketing intelligence and e-commerce solutions. The company is well-positioned in a growing market, as e-commerce brands increasingly seek data-driven insights to optimize their marketing strategies.

Company Size: Northbeam is a small but rapidly growing company with 11-50 employees. This size allows for a more agile and collaborative work environment, where individual contributions can have a significant impact on the company's success.

Founded: Northbeam was founded in 2019, making it a relatively young company with a strong focus on innovation and growth.

Company Description:

  • Northbeam is a marketing intelligence platform that empowers e-commerce brands with data-driven insights to drive profitable growth
  • The company specializes in collecting first-party data and using machine learning to provide actionable insights into customer buying behavior
  • Northbeam operates as a hybrid-remote company, with team members across the US and Canada
